Osho’s ultimate message on the Heart Sutra is one of celebration. When one truly understands that form is emptiness and emptiness is form, life becomes a play (Leela). If nothing is permanent and nothing is solid, there is nothing to fear. There is nothing to lose and nothing to gain.
Osho (1931–1990) never claimed to be a Buddhist in the traditional sense. He famously said, “I am not a Buddhist, but I am a Buddha.” His approach to the Heart Sutra was unique: he did not treat it as a religious document to be worshipped, but as a scientific map of consciousness to be experienced. | | OSHO Online Library | HTML |
The Buddha-nature is not a "self" in the way we understand it. It is an open sky. When the boundaries of the ego dissolve, one does not disappear; instead, one becomes the whole. Osho teaches that this disappearance of the false self is the only way to attain true bliss. Fear exists only because we defend a center that isn't really there.
